The Medical Examiner Service has been created because it has been recognised that an independent scrutiny of a death, undertaken by a Medical Examiner, who is a qualified and trained doctor but who is independent of any care provided and the organisation who provided it, allows the cause of death to be more accurately identified, and the circumstances surrounding the death to be more objectively assessed in order to identify any concerns about the treatment or care provided that may require further investigation. Medical examiner officer training:Medical examiner training involves the completion of 26 core e-learning modules, followed by attendance at a face-to-face training day. In response to a number of public inquiries, most notably the Shipman Inquiry (third report), Report of the Mid Staffordshire NHS Foundation Trust Public Inquiry (vol 2) and the Morecambe Bay Investigation, the Government is reforming the process of death certification in England and Wales. Medical Examiner Officers (MEOs) are a vital part of any Medical Examiner (ME) service in England, Wales, Northern Ireland and Gibraltar.
